100% Free Download | Install Now | Free Software Download
SponsoredDownload official version of Mozilla Firefox for your PC! 100% Free download! Download …Firefox Browser New Version | New Version Download
SponsoredDownload Firefox Fast & Private Browser today and make your daily life easier than ever. …
